The 2014 Baden Masters were held from August 29 to 31 at the in Baden, Switzerland as part of the 2014–15 World Curling Tour and the European .[1] The event was the first tournament of the season for both tours. The event was held in a round robin format, and the purse for the event was CHF 32,500, of which the winner, Thomas Ulsrud, received CHF 13,030.[2] Ulsrud and his team from Norway defeated the Peter de Cruz rink from Geneva in the final with a score of 6–5. It was the second time the Ulrsud rink won the event (they had previously won in 2008).
